在Linux系统中创建DB2实例涉及几个关键步骤。以下是一个基础的概念性指南,以及相关的操作步骤:
DB2是IBM的一款关系型数据库管理系统(RDBMS),它支持多种操作系统,包括Linux。创建DB2实例意味着在Linux系统上配置一个独立的数据库环境,可以独立于其他DB2实例运行。
db2icrt
命令创建一个新的DB2实例。例如,创建一个名为myinstance
的实例:db2icrt
命令创建一个新的DB2实例。例如,创建一个名为myinstance
的实例:-s ese
:指定使用Express Edition(可选其他版本)。-u db2inst1
:指定实例所有者用户名。-p password
:指定实例所有者密码。-a
:自动启动实例。-w 1024
:设置实例的初始堆大小。db2start
命令启动实例:db2start
命令启动实例:db2level
命令验证DB2版本和实例状态:db2level
命令验证DB2版本和实例状态:sudo
提升权限。以下是一个简化的示例脚本,用于自动化创建DB2实例的过程:
#!/bin/bash
# 安装DB2软件(假设已经下载了安装包)
sudo rpm -ivh db2-server-linux-x86_64-11.5.5.0-linuxx64.rpm
# 创建实例
sudo db2icrt -s ese -u db2inst1 -p password -a -w 1024 myinstance
# 切换到实例所有者用户
sudo su - db2inst1
# 设置环境变量
. ~/.bash_profile
# 启动实例
db2start
# 验证实例
db2level
通过以上步骤,你应该能够在Linux系统上成功创建一个DB2实例。如果遇到具体问题,可以根据错误信息进行排查,或参考IBM官方文档获取更多帮助。
领取专属 10元无门槛券
手把手带您无忧上云